Engineers India commissions Visakh Refinery RUF

The commissioning of the Residue Upgradation Facility (RUF) at HPCL’s Visakh Refinery, featuring the world’s first and largest LC-Max unit, marks a major milestone in India’s refining sector.

Engineers India Limited (EIL), as Project Management Consultant, delivered end-to-end project management services for this globally benchmarked facility under the Visakh Refinery Modernization Project (VRMP), with Larsen & Toubro (L&T) as the EPC contractor.

The 3.55 MMTPA facility deploys LC-Max technology at an unprecedented scale, enabling around 93% conversion of residue into high-value distillates, significantly enhancing refinery margins and complexity.

The successful commissioning reflects strong collaboration among all stakeholders and reinforces EIL’s capability in delivering complex, large-scale energy projects aligned with the vision of Atmanirbhar Bharat.
